| US 7,430,599 B2 | ||
| Method and system for centralized network usage tracking | ||
| Rico Mariani, Kirkland, Wash. (US); Lee Wang, Kirkland, Wash. (US); Madhan Subhas, Kirkland, Wash. (US); Ramesh Manne, Redmond, Wash. (US); Tara S. Prakriya, Redmond, Wash. (US); and Tarek Najm, Kirkland, Wash. (US) | ||
| Assigned to Microsoft Corporation, Redmond, Wash. (US) | ||
| Filed on Mar. 31, 2006, as Appl. No. 11/278,302. | ||
| Application 11/278302 is a division of application No. 09/704196, filed on Oct. 31, 2000, granted, now 7,103,657. | ||
| Prior Publication US 2006/0179133 A1, Aug. 10, 2006 | ||
| Int. Cl. G06F 15/173 (2006.01) | ||
| U.S. Cl. 709—224 [709/200; 709/203; 709/223; 709/225; 709/226; 709/238] | 18 Claims |

| 1. A method for centralized network usage tracking, comprising:
configuring a web page to include a tracking tag, wherein the tracking tag comprises a referral to content stored on a logging
server and includes information about transmission of the web page from a web server to a client;
accessing, by the client, the webpage including the tracking tag;
transmitting the web page accessed including the tracking tag from the web server to the client;
rendering the transmitted web page on the client, wherein the rendering of the transmitted web page comprises sending a request
by the client to the logging server for delivery of the content identified by the tracking tag;
receiving, at the logging server, the request for delivery of the content from the client;
logging the information included within the tracking tag at the logging server; and
sending a trivial response as the content identified by the tracking tag in a resource sent from the logging server to the
client, wherein the trivial response is configured to minimize resource expenditures by the client in rendering the trivial
response as part of the web page.
